Jada Pinkett Smith Responds to Chris Rock’s Oscars 2016 Dis: ‘We Gotta Keep It Moving’

Jada Pinkett Smith isn’t focusing on the past. The 44-year-old actress told photographers at Los Angeles International Airport on Saturday, March 5, that she is moving forward after Chris Rock slammed her at last week’s Academy Awards.

During the comedian’s opening monologue, he poked fun at Pinkett Smith’s decision to boycott the Oscars for a lack of diversity among the 2016 acting nominees.

“Jada said she’s not coming,” Rock, 51, said. “I was like, ‘Isn’t she on a TV show?’ Jada’s gonna boycott the Oscars? Jada boycotting the Oscars is like me boycotting Rihanna’s panties. I wasn’t invited!”

However, Pinkett Smith seemed unfazed as she strutted past photographers at LAX on Saturday.

“It comes with the territory, sweetheart,” she told X17. “Hey, look, it comes with the territory, but we gotta keep it moving. We gotta keep it moving. We gotta keep it moving. There’s a lot of stuff we gotta handle, a lot of stuff in our world right now. We gotta keep it moving.”

Rock also took at shot at the actress’ husband, Will Smith, during his hosting gig.

“It’s not fair that Will was this good and didn’t get nominated,” he said of the actor’s role in Concussion. “It’s also not fair that Will was paid $20 million for Wild Wild West!”
